Explanation

Acid rain is primarily caused by the emission of sulfur dioxide (SO2) and nitrogen oxides (NOx) into the atmosphere [2]. These gases are released largely through the combustion of fossil fuels in power plants, industrial processes, and motor vehicles [3]. Once in the atmosphere, sulfur dioxide reacts with water, oxygen, and other chemicals to undergo oxidation, forming sulfuric acid (H2SO4) [4]. Similarly, nitrogen oxides form nitric acid (HNO3) [2]. These acids mix with atmospheric moisture and precipitate as rain, snow, or fog with a pH typically lower than 5.6 [4]. While ozone acts as a photo-oxidant that can stimulate these reactions, and ammonia can react with acids to form salts, sulfur dioxide remains a direct primary precursor and a major cause of the acidification process [6]. Carbon monoxide, though a pollutant, does not contribute to acid rain formation [5].
